Srinagar : Police on Monday said that it has arrested an accused involved in the illegal felling, theft and transportation of forest produce in the Warpora forest area of Sopore. Stolen willow timber along with the horse cart used in the commission of the offence was seized.
In a statement issued here on Monday Police said that while acting on specific inputs a case of forest theft was detected byit in the Warpora forest area and one accused involved in the illegal extraction and transportation of forest produce was arrested. A police party from Police Post Warpora rushed to the spot after receiving credible inputs regarding the illegal felling and theft of willow timber from the forest area. During the operation, one individual was found transporting illegally felled willow logs on a horse cart. The accused has been identified as Manzoor Ahmad Ganaie S/O Mohammad Shabir Ganaie R/O Jalalabad, Sopore. The stolen willow timber along with the horse cart used for its transportation was seized on the spot. In this connection a case under FIR No. 136/2026 under Section 303(2) BNS and Section 26-F of the Forest Act has been registered at Police Station Sopore and investigation has also been taken up.
